Arbitrary file read via unnormalized GET paths
Published May 25, 2026 · Updated May 25, 2026
Path traversal in VisionTrack VT1000 Viewing Software vt1000 allows remote attackers to read arbitrary files through crafted GET paths. The HTTP request path handler accepts relative traversal sequences without normalizing the path or confining file access to its intended directory. Unauthenticated network access to the service on TCP port 8080 is sufficient, and successful requests disclose any file readable by the service process.
